Donald Arvid Nelson, born May 15, 1940, in Muskegon, Michigan, is a name synonymous with innovative basketball strategy and a touch of unconventional thinking. Before becoming the coaching legend we know and love, Nelson enjoyed a successful playing career, spanning 14 seasons in the NBA.

He played for the Los Angeles Lakers, Chicago Zephyrs/Baltimore Bullets, and Boston Celtics, where he won five NBA championships. It was with the Celtics where Nelson learned from the great Red Auerbach, soaking up knowledge that would shape his future coaching philosophy.

After retiring as a player, Nelson transitioned to coaching, taking his first head coaching gig with the Milwaukee Bucks in 1976. This marked the beginning of a remarkable coaching journey that would see him lead several NBA teams, including the Golden State Warriors (twice), New York Knicks, and Dallas Mavericks.

It was during his time with the Warriors that Nelson truly revolutionized the game with his "Nellie Ball" offense, a fast-paced, free-flowing system that emphasized spacing, ball movement, and three-point shooting. He took the Warriors to the playoffs multiple times, and even engineered a stunning upset of the top-seeded Dallas Mavericks in 2007 – still considered one of the biggest upsets in NBA playoff history.

Nelson's coaching career is a testament to his basketball acumen, his willingness to challenge conventional wisdom, and his ability to connect with players. He officially retired from coaching in 2010, leaving behind a legacy that continues to influence the game today.
